Lucy wants to develop a web page to display her profile. She wants to just start with a basic page that lists her accomplishment
Pachacha [2.7K]

Lucy can use <u>unordered list</u> for listing her accomplishments.

<u>Explanation:</u>

Unordered list would work best for listing Lucy's accomplishments. The unordered list is defined as the collection of specific items that have no sequence or special order. This list can be created using HTML tag.

UL offers listing of items in no particular order. <ul> tag can be used to create the unordered list. Lucy can simply create a page and add her work history and computer courses taken by her in the unordered list. So that it can be identified clearly.

Why were places such as Georgia and Alabama considered as "ground zero" for the American Civil rights movement? Please include s
SashulF [63]
In this case, "ground zero" means the starting point for an activity (like the American Civil Rights Movement). Georgia and Alabama were considered the starting points for this movement due to events such as the Montgomery Bus Boycott (after Rosa Parks refused to give up her seat to a white man) and the campaign to end segregation in Albany, Georgia. These events began the domino effect for the Civil Rights Movement, inspiring other protests and demonstrations to occur across the country.
